Output 58309601609013df148d48b73246358412eb056e61c7f3ef8a80a8277c50b0f1:0

value
122045
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f9e4c24027c7733f6854573dc6358ea653718cf OP_EQUAL
address
38wzwPwAfhx16tHqcNekAZuUTWY49FTgrg
transaction
58309601609013df148d48b73246358412eb056e61c7f3ef8a80a8277c50b0f1
spent
true